Can I hijack this thread to ask a question?
I upgraded to BBYW Option 1 a few months ago and took advantage of the free BT Voyager 210 router. If I now upgrade to BBYW Option 2, can I get the free one port wireless router and what would happen to my Voyager 210? Would I need to return this?
Thanks - Bob

Hi Bob,
If you were to upgrade to Broadband Your Way option 2, we would be able to send you the wireless router, but we would need you to pay for your Voyager 210, which would cost £29.99.
